A related effort is FORSiM (Fast Oxidation Reaction in Si-technology-based Microreactors) which is funded by the Dutch Technology Foundation and is a cooperative venture between the University of Twente and the Technical University of Eindhoven. The objective of this work is to build and operate the first microreactor for catalytic partial oxidation for small-scale and on-demand hydrogen production61. [Pg.126]
